Are kabob and kebab the same?

Are kabob and kebab the same?

The words kabob and kebab refer to the same delicacy that is prepared with chunks of meat grilled on a skewer. Turkish shish kebab is called shish kabob by Americans and they make it by threading meat balls on a skewer along with vegetables and tomatoes and eating the cooked meat directly from the stick.

What’s the difference between a shish kabob and a kabob?

In English, kebab, or in North America also kabob, often occurring as shish kebab, is now a culinary term for small pieces of meat cooked on a skewer.

What is a kabob in the UK?

Doner kebab (also spelled döner kebab) (UK: /ˈdɒnər kɪˈbæb/, US: /ˈdoʊnər kɪˈbɑːb/; Turkish: döner or döner kebap [dœˈneɾ ceˈbap]) is a type of kebab, made of meat cooked on a vertical rotisserie. The operator uses a knife to slice thin shavings from the outer layer of the meat as it cooks.

Is it spelled kabob or kebab?

Kebab, (also kebap, kabob, kebob, or kabab) is an Iranian, Afghan, Middle Eastern, Eastern Mediterranean, and South Asian dish of pieces of meat, fish, or vegetables roasted or grilled on a skewer or spit originating either in the Eastern Mediterranean, or the Middle East, before spreading worldwide.

What’s the definition of Kabob?

: cubes of meat (such as lamb or beef) marinated and cooked with vegetables usually on a skewer.

What is donner meat UK?

lamb
The traditional doner kebab meat is lamb. Today, chicken, veal, turkey, and beef are cooked in the same manner, with a combination of veal leg meat, lamb meat, and lamb tail fat being a combination in Turkey. (Fatty cuts keep the meat moist and flavorful as it cooks on the rotisserie.)

What is the difference between kebab and gyros?

While a gyros, like a doner kebab, is make with meat from a large rotating spit, souvlaki are individual skewers threaded with small chunks of meat. Said pieces are sometimes taken off the skewer and served wrapped in bread, creating a pretty close cousin to the gyro.
